Mangalruu, Jul 12: SHINE Foundation successfully organised VISTARA 2026 – Open House Session & Workshop with Industry Leaders on 6th & 7th July 2026 at Sahyadri Campus, Mangaluru, under the Karnataka Acceleration Network (KAN) initiative.
The two-day event brought together 55+ startup founders, entrepreneurs, students, ecosystem enablers, and aspiring innovators, creating a vibrant platform for collaboration, knowledge exchange, and entrepreneurial growth. The workshop featured 7 distinguished industry leaders, who shared practical insights drawn from their entrepreneurial, investment, and business leadership experiences.




The event was inaugurated in the presence of CS Manu Francis, Rohith Ananth, Krishna Hegde, Dr S S Injaganeri, Nanjunda Pratap Palecanda, Bharath Oswal, Johnson Tellis marking the beginning of two days of engaging discussions and impactful learning.
Expert sessions
• CS Manu Francis – Decoding Startup Valuation & Fundraising
• Nanjunda Pratap Palecanda – What Does It Take to Build a Scalable Business?
• Bharath Oswal – Investor Readiness, Marketing & Brand Positioning
• S.L. Sriram – QMS & Regulatory Framework
• CA Gautham Pai D – Financial Strategies & Capital Access
The event also featured special addresses by Suvin, KAN program head, KDEM, and Vaishak Pai, Mangaluru cluster head, KDEM, highlighting the importance of strengthening Karnataka's startup ecosystem beyond Bengaluru.
